News D'Amboise, Wright and Woods Set for Chicago's "Talkback" Series Chicago's "Talkback Tuesdays" series, the post-show discussion series that launched in 2008 with director Walter Bobbie, will continue in March.

Following the March 10 performance of the long-running, Tony-winning revival of Kander and Ebb's Chicago at the Ambassador Theatre, current Roxie Hart Charlotte d'Amboise (Tony nominee for A Chorus Line) will take part in a discussion and question-and-answer session.

Amra-Faye Wright and Carol Woods, Broadway's current Velma Kelly and Matron "Mama" Morton, respectively, will pair-up for a joint talkback following the March 24 performance.

The series, according to press notes, is designed to "provide theatregoers with an exclusive, behind-the-scenes glimpse into the world of Chicago."
